    3. Draw a curved line for the vine’s stem.

    Once you have your vine’s starting point, draw a curved line to represent the stem. The stem should be thin and flexible, and it should curve in a natural way. You can make the stem as long or short as you like, and you can also add branches to it if you want.

    4. Add leaves and tendrils to the stem.

    Once you have the stem of your vine drawn, you can add leaves and tendrils. Leaves can be drawn in a variety of ways, but the most common way is to draw a simple oval shape with a point at the end. Tendrils are thin, curling lines that attach to the leaves and stem. You can add as many leaves and tendrils as you like, but make sure they are evenly spaced along the stem.
